Factors Affecting Cost
- Material Quality: Higher-grade cement and aggregates can increase costs but offer better durability.
- Labor Rates: Local labor rates in Naperville can vary, influencing the total expense.
- Sidewalk Length and Width: Larger dimensions require more materials and labor, raising the cost.
- Site Preparation: Costs may rise if extensive grading or removal of existing structures is needed.
- Permits and Inspections: Fees for local permits and required inspections can add to the overall cost.
- Design Complexity: Intricate designs or additional features like decorative finishes can increase expenses.
- Weather Conditions: Seasonal weather variations in Naperville might affect construction timelines and costs.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task Description | Average Cost (USD) |
---|---|
Basic Sidewalk Installation | $8 - $12 per square foot |
Site Preparation | $1,000 - $3,000 |
Permits and Inspections | $100 - $500 |
Decorative Finishes | $5 - $10 per square foot |
Removal of Old Sidewalk | $500 - $2,000 |
Grading and Excavation | $1,500 - $4,000 |
Reinforcement (Rebar) | $2 - $3 per square foot |
